Least Common Multiple of 80107 and 80120 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80107 and 80120, than apply into the LCM equation.

GCF(80107,80120) = 1
LCM(80107,80120) = ( 80107 × 80120) / 1
LCM(80107,80120) = 6418172840 / 1
LCM(80107,80120) = 6418172840
